Pharmaceutical company vehicles allowed entry into Islamabad

Islamabad (Pakistan Desk) Federal Interior Minister Senator Mohsin Naqvi has directed that vehicles of pharmaceutical companies be allowed to enter Islamabad.

The Interior Minister contacted the Chief Commissioner and Deputy Commissioner Islamabad regarding the restriction on pharmaceutical vehicles and took immediate notice of the issue.

He said that the entry of all necessary vehicles for the supply of medicines into the capital must be ensured at all costs, and no delay or obstruction in this process will be tolerated.

Mohsin Naqvi made it clear that the supply of medicines to the public should not be affected and immediate administrative steps should be taken to restore and ensure an effective supply chain.
